Nathaniel Levin
Caption: Nathaniel Levin
Actor Source: IMDB Nathaniel Levin is an actor, known for Trash Can on the Left (2015), Deadly Affairs (2012) and Brain Games (2011).
Brett Luciana Murray pictures →
William Marquart pictures →
David A. Jørgensen pictures →